321     (this is separate code, and therefore not under pkg)
322     lsopt/, optim/
323     o Updated verification/carbon/
324     - #define GM_VISBECK_VARIABLE_K
325     - GM_taper_scheme = 'ldd97'
326 heimbach 1.103
327     checkpoint46n_post
328     Merging from release1_p8:
329     o verification/natl_box:
330     updating new external_fields_load routine
331     o New package: pkg/seaice
332     Sea ice model by D. Menemenlis (JPL) and Jinlun Zhang (Seattle).
333     The sea-ice code is based on Hibler (1979-1980).
334     Two sea-ice dynamic solvers, ADI and LSR, are included.

427     o update timeave pkg for wVel diagnostic.
428     checkpoint46j_pre
429 mlosch 1.87
430 jmc 1.88 checkpoint46i_post
431     o Clean up AIM package (and keep the results unchanged):
432     include CPP_OPTION and use IMPLICT NONE in all routines ;
433     declare all the variables _RL ; use _d 0 for all numerical constants.
434     use ifdef ALLOW_AIM everywhere. And now AIM can be used with g77 !
435 mlosch 1.87
436     checkpoint46h_post

613 jmc 1.68 o vertical grid option: allow to put the Interface at the middle between
614     2 cell-centers ; replace delZ in pkg/kpp by drF.
615 jmc 1.67 o GM Advective form: Tracers are advected using the residual transport (=
616     Euler+GM-bolus); set param GM_AdvSeparate=T to return to previous form.
617 jmc 1.66
618     checkpoint44g_post
619     o fix surface correction term in multiDimAdvection (affects plume_on_slope
620     results) ; ifdef missing in thermodynamics.F
621 adcroft 1.65
622     checkpoint44f_pre,checkpoint44f_post
623     o added PTRACERS package
624     This allows an arbitrary number of passive tracers to be integrated
625     forward simultaneously with the dynamicaly model.
626     + Implemented so far:
627     - basic forward algorithm (time-stepping, advection, diffusion, convection)
